Delta Force is the real deal no hand holding, no flashy gimmicks, just straight up tactical warfare. Unlike Battlefield 2042 and the COD series, where they flopped, this game actually makes you think. You can’t just run in like a hero; one wrong move and you’re done. The open maps are massive, letting you approach missions however you want sniping from a distance, sneaking in like a ghost, or going full assault. And unlike modern shooters that feel more like laser tag, Delta Force has that raw, realistic combat that actually makes every shot count. Yeah, the graphics are good enough, but the gameplay? just timeless. No forced micro transactions and on top also you just get free weapon skins just by grinding ranks, no crazy futuristic nonsense just a pure, tactical shooter that tests your skills. If you miss the days when shooters required brains, not just reflexes, this one hits way harder than any modern FPS.

Death Stranding: Director’s Cut is one of the most unique game I’ve ever played, but I won’t lie the first few hours it really test your patience. You’ll probably feel like uninstalling it, but trust me, stick with it. Once you get into the story, it’s a whole different gravy. You play as Sam Porter Bridges, delivering packages across a post apocalyptic world to reconnect humanity. Sounds simple, but between dodging creepy BTs, dealing with wild weather, and managing your cargo, it gets intense. The visuals are stunning, the music playlist is just fire, and the story? Deep, very emotional, and super weird in the best way. If you’re patient and down for something different, this game is an experience you won’t forget. Stick with it it’s worth it.

Uncharted: Legacy of Thieves Collection is an absolute banger. I just finished it, and wow, it gives me major tomb raider vibes with all the treasure hunting, climbing, and epic action. It’s got two of the best adventures Uncharted 4 and The Lost Legacy remastered with stunning visuals that make every moment feel insane. Playing as Nate and Chloe, with wild set pieces and cinematic scenes that’ll keep you interested. The climbing and exploring? Super fun. The fights? Intense. And the storytelling? Chef’s kiss. What really fascinated me, though, was how much ancient history the game dives into. You learn about civilizations, myths, gods and legends while piecing together clues, and it’s actually so cool. If you’re into adventures, treasure hunting, and games that make you feel like a total badass, this collection is 100% worth it. It’s the kind of game that makes you feel like you’re living an action movie, and honestly, I didn’t want it to end.

The Last of Us Part 1 had me straight up emotional, no lie. It’s all about Joel and Ellie trying to survive in a world that’s completely messed up, with infected zombies and people who are somehow worse. The gameplay slaps ngl sneaking through, crafting items, and those intense fights had me stressed but hooked. The graphics are top tier, and the emotional moments? They just hit different. Once you finish the main story, you have to check out Left Behind. It dives into Ellie’s backstory with her bestie, how she got bitten, and how she saved Joel. It ties everything together and hits just as hard. If you’re into games that give you all the feels while keeping the action intense, this one’s a total must play.

The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t is hands down one of the best games I’ve ever played. You step into Geralt’s boots, a monster hunter with serious skills and a no nonsense vibe, exploring this insanely huge and gorgeous open world. Every quest feels like it matters even the side missions are deep. Trust me, you need to complete all the secondary quests before diving into the main story; it’s worth it. The combat is fun once you get the hang of it, and the choices you make actually matter, changing how the story plays out. The botchling monster? xd yeah, that thing gave me a hard time, but once I learned how to use signs properly, it got easier. Big shoutout to my friend, who really helped me out while I was playing. He taught me how to grind for better gear, use mutagens, and play smarter. Some of the stories hit so deep, they stayed with me even after I finished the game. If you love RPGs or just want a game with an emotional punch, you’ve gotta check this out.

Just wrapped up Heavy Rain, which I got in a bundle with Beyond: Two Souls and Detroit: Become Human, and it was hell of a ride! You dive into a mystery where four characters are trying to catch the “Origami Killer” before it’s too late. Every choice you make changes the story, and there are so many ways it can end. The graphics are a bit old school, but the plot is super gripping and keeps you on your toes. I felt like an investigator for a while, and I even figured out who the killer was in my head before the game revealed it guess that’s just how smart I am, hehe xd. If you love dark, suspenseful crime thrillers where your decisions matter, Heavy Rain is totally worth checking out no cap!
